A) went B) have gone C) has gone
A) read B) has read C) have read
A) has been to B) was in C) have been to
A) saw B) have seen C) has seen
A) went B) have gone C) has gone
A) already completed B) have already completed C) has already completed
A) has started B) have started C) started
A) have given up B) gave up C) has given up
A) was never B) have never been C) has never been
A) has been B) was C) have been
A) have learnt B) learnt C) has learnt
A) began B) has begun C) have begun
A) have lost B) has lost C) lost
A) has read B) have read C) read
A) studied B) have studied C) has studied
A) already called B) has already called C) have already called
A) didn't finish B) haven't finished C) hasn't finished
A) have eaten B) ate C) has eaten
A) didn't visit B) haven't visited C) hasn't visited
A) have just bought B) has just bought C) just bought |